## Provenance: Vexagram Undo/Redo Module

The undo/redo stack in Vexagram 4.2 was rebuilt after the history-replay audit. All command objects are now serialized deterministically; the builder is hermetic and pinned. Reviewers should confirm the attestation chain covers both the editor core and the replay shim. No unsigned inputs were observed in the final run. The attested build token appears below.

pipeline stamp: htk3_69f

Subject: Key rotation — PayStream export service

Hi on-call,

As part of the payroll export format change shipping Thursday, we rotated the PayStream export key. The old key stops working at 02:00 UTC Friday; please update the exporter config before then and verify a dry-run export completes. The new key for the PayStream export service is below.

service key, kawip-kahop: kto4_QQzB

## Budget Request — Orilux Platform (Managers Only)

For the incoming director: Orilux engineering requests a 12% uplift for FY26, driven by datacenter migration in Velmarsh. Ops approved scope; finance flagged timing. Decision needed before the Q2 lockdown. Supporting figures are in the capex annex. Context for the request follows directly below.

internal memo for kaduf-baduf: Only 35 of the 378 pilot accounts renewed Holir, so a churn review is set for June 11. Eliielax Group is in early talks to buy Silaelix Group for about $142.1 million.

## Limits and quotas: session-token refresh

Quick context before the next release: Plover's token refresher was stampeding the auth service because every client refreshed at exactly the same offset before expiry. We added jitter and per-client refresh quotas, which fixed the thundering herd but means tokens can now live slightly longer than before. Nothing alarming, just know the tradeoff exists. Current limits are as follows.

tuning table, yajog-yahof:
BUDGETS = {
    "lamvan": 303,
    "wenox": 460,
    "fenvan": 525,
}